CRO adaptation sequence
A fractional CRO adapts the system in an order that protects the number: first the commercial facts, then the operating rhythm, then assisted execution.
Locate the actual bottleneck: market, conversion, capacity, retention, or decision latency.
Tighten stages, definitions, and source records until forecast conversations use the same facts.
Clarify who can change price, route an account, approve an exception, or override a recommendation.
Deploy agents into the narrow work where outputs can be checked and responsibility remains visible.
Inspect leading evidence, not activity volume, and change the motion only when the evidence supports it.
